Transaction 311c21c169d8c486bef3a6d48b4cb1f2c9889e454835a1cd16380f9c2f9f8a4c
1 Input
1 Outputs
- 311c21c169d8c486bef3a6d48b4cb1f2c9889e454835a1cd16380f9c2f9f8a4c:0
value 1503310
address 34tdX4WDvCBXqCepcbK7Yqt5E6vmpXV7Bj